Part 1. Is T-Mobile SIM Unlock Legal and Safe?
According to the Unlocking Consumer Choice and Wireless Competition Act, customers have the right to unlock their devices if they meet their carrier's terms and conditions. The FCC report further states that the unlocking is safe and does not void the warranty when done through legal methods. Unlike unblocking, the T-Mobile unlock phone process simply removes the software restrictions that prevent you from using other networks.

T-Mobile SIM Unlock Policy and Eligibility Rules to Know
Since the process is legal and safe, review the mentioned points and determine if you meet the T-Mobile SIM unlocking criteria:
- The device must be sold by T-Mobile and must not be reported as lost or stolen.
- Your account must be active and have a positive payment history.
- The device must be active on the T-Mobile network for at least 40 days.
- The account must be completely paid off, and if it was canceled, it must have zero balance.
- At least 365 days must have passed since the device was first activated on the T-Mobile network.
- If it hasn’t been a year, the prepaid account must have more than $100 in refills for each active line. In addition, the device must have been active for at least 14 days.
- T-Mobile will unlock your device immediately if you are being deployed and have shown deployment papers.
- The unlock is limited to 2 mobile devices per line of service every 12 months.
Part 2. 3 Ways - Check If Your T-Mobile Phone Is SIM Locked
If you meet the T-Mobile carrier unlock requirements, the next step is to check the SIM lock status. Hence, from Android to iOS and app/online ways, this section lists a detailed guide below:
Way 1. Check via Settings
This method requires an additional SIM or a website and can be performed on Android and iOS. In addition, it gives an instant confirmation from anywhere and is guided ahead:
For Android
Instructions. Pick the “SIM Cards & Mobile Networks” option, select the SIM, and tap “Mobile Networks.” After that, toggle the “Automatically Select Network” option; if you don’t see a carrier list, it's locked.

For iPhone
Instructions. Choose "About" in the General settings, and find the “Network Provider Lock” option. If it does not say “No SIM Restrictions,” the phone is locked.

Way 2. Use the T-Mobile App [Device Unlock] Or T-Mobile Online Account
Through this method, you can continue the SIM lock removal method after checking the lock status. In this regard, you simply click the “Allow” button, and you can then manage your line step by step. As another method, you can go to the T-Mobile website account page and tap the “Check Your Unlock Status” option to view your account details.

Way 3. The “Different SIM” Test
As you continue with the T-Mobile unlock phone methods, try to swap the SIM from a different network. Power off the phone, add the new SIM, and if it doesn’t pick up signals after turning it back on, it's locked. Additionally, you can also get “SIM Not Supported” or “Enter Network Unlock Code” alerts.
Part 3. Unlock T-Mobile Phone SIM: Full Walkthrough for Beginners
Regarding the T-Mobile SIM unlock ways, here are some official and safe options you can opt for:
Method 1. Request SIM Unlock Directly from T-Mobile
If you want to contact T-Mobile directly, there are 2 options you can try:

Option 1: Official T-Mobile Remote Unlock (Preferred)
T-Mobile says that as long as the phone is unlockable remotely, it will automatically unlock within 2 business days when you meet the unlocking requirements. Once that, the device unlock status can be checked in the T-Mobile application or on the online site.
Option 2: Requesting Unlock for iPhone
You can use this option to unlock an iPhone, since there is no Device Unlock app for iOS users. You have to contact “1-800-937-8997” and ask the representatives to submit the SIM unlock request. After that, you will get a confirmation email within 2 days, if eligible. The iPhone will connect to Apple's servers and automatically activate the unlock.
Method 2. Use T-Mobile Device Unlock App (Android)
Many T-Mobile Android devices, such as Samsung, Motorola, LG, and OnePlus, have the preinstalled app Device Unlock. Hence, users can use this for T-Mobile carrier unlock and choose from permanent or temporary unlock options. Later, the app allows you to restart the device and update the lock status without contacting support, as guided:
Instructions. Insert the SIM and grant the necessary permissions on the app by pressing the “Allow” button. After that, choose the “Permanent Unlock” option and wait till the request is processed. Once done, press “Restart Now,” and your SIM lock will be removed in real time.

Part 4. How Much Does It Cost to Unlock T-Mobile Phones?
According to the FCC's consumer guidelines, carriers can no longer impose extra charges for unlocking a compatible device. So, if you're wondering about the charges for the T-Mobile unlock phone, note that it's free for current and former customers who meet T-Mobile's eligibility criteria. 1. Can T-Mobile unlock a phone I bought from AT&T or Verizon?
No, T-Mobile can unlock the device only if it was sold by them originally. If you have another carrier with the phone on T-Mobile, you will need to contact the other carrier and ask them for an unlock before you can use the phone elsewhere. -
2. Can I unlock my T-Mobile phone if I’m moving abroad for military service?
Yes, T-Mobile provides expedited unlocking for military personnel with deployment orders. In this case, you don’t have to meet the 40- or 365-day requirement, but the device must be in good condition and have deployment papers submitted. -
3. Does T-Mobile unlock Blacklisted or Blocked devices?
If the device is reported lost or stolen, or has been blocked due to fraudulent activity, it cannot be unlocked. Thus, you need to resolve the block with the original account holder or T-Mobile’s fraud department.
